SpletThe baptism is an event that is very important in Jesus’ ministry. In this story we see clearly the relationship between Father and Son and the use of the title ‘Son of God’. The events … Narrated in each of the four Gospels, the baptism of Jesus marks the inauguration of His public ministry — His emergence from a life of seeming obscurity into a life of growing popularity on account of His preaching, miracles, healings and proclamation of mercy and forgiveness. SpletThe baptism of Jesus marked the official beginning of his ministry. This is the time Jesus publicly showed his choice to follow God’s will. Until this time he most probably lived in Nazareth working as a carpenter like Joseph. Jesus probably walked about 70 miles from Nazareth to the Jordan River near Jericho. Purification rites in water were quite common and also a common daily practice among the Jews at that time (Mark 7: 1-4). In the Greek translation of the Old Testament, the word baptize means immersion, which results in permanent change.
